Assembling Your Mint Chocolate Chip Masterpiece
Once your soft and chewy cookies have cooled completely, the real fun begins: assembly! For six perfect sandwiches, select twelve of your finest chocolate cake mix cookies. Take a generous scoop of your favorite mint chocolate chip ice cream – ensure it’s slightly softened for easier scooping, but not melted – and place it onto the flat bottom of one cookie. This is where the magic starts to happen.
Next, gently place another cookie on top of the ice cream, pressing down lightly until the ice cream spreads towards the edges. The goal is to create a well-formed sandwich without squishing the ice cream out too much or breaking the cookies. Repeat this process for the remaining cookies and ice cream until all your sandwiches are assembled. At this point, you can certainly stop and enjoy them as is, or you can take them to the next level of deliciousness and visual appeal!

To create your chocolate coating, gently melt semi-sweet chocolate chips with a touch of butter until smooth and glossy. The butter helps create a more fluid, dippable consistency. Once melted, dip half of each assembled ice cream sandwich into the warm chocolate, allowing any excess to drip off. While the chocolate is still wet, generously sprinkle with your favorite candy sprinkles. For an even easier option, you can use a store-bought magic shell topping, which hardens almost instantly upon contact with the cold ice cream. After dipping, pop the cookie sandwiches back into the freezer to firm up the chocolate shell and chill thoroughly until you’re ready to serve. For longer storage, wrap each individual sandwich in freezer paper or plastic wrap, and they’ll be ready to enjoy whenever a craving strikes.

Expert Tips for Flawless Ice Cream Sandwiches
To ensure your homemade Mint Chocolate Chip Cookie Ice Cream Sandwiches turn out perfectly every time, here are a few expert tips: First, always start with truly soft cookies. If your cookies are too hard, they will be difficult to bite into when frozen, potentially crumbling and creating a mess. Second, make sure your ice cream is firm but slightly pliable when scooping. If it’s too hard, it will be difficult to spread evenly; if it’s too soft, it will melt too quickly during assembly. A good trick is to let the ice cream sit out for about 5-10 minutes before you start assembling.
Third, work quickly! The faster you assemble, the less time the ice cream has to melt. Once assembled, immediately place the sandwiches into the freezer. This initial chill helps them firm up quickly before any optional dipping. Fourth, for dipping, ensure your melted chocolate is not too hot, as this can melt the ice cream. A slightly warm, thin chocolate coating works best. Finally, for long-term storage, individually wrap each sandwich tightly in plastic wrap or freezer paper to prevent freezer burn and maintain freshness. This way, you can enjoy these delightful treats for weeks to come!

Mint Chocolate Chip Cookie Ice Cream Sandwiches
By: Dee
Mint Chocolate Chip Cookie Ice Cream Sandwiches made with soft and chewy cake mix cookies are perfect for an easy make ahead frozen summer dessert!
Average Rating: 5 stars from 14 votes
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 20 minutes
- Freezer Time: 1 hour
- Total Time: 1 hour 35 minutes
- Servings: 6
Ingredients
For the Cookies
- 1 box chocolate cake mix
- 2 eggs
- ⅓ cup coconut oil or vegetable oil or melted butter
- 2 teaspoons milk
For the Cookie Ice Cream Sandwiches
- 12 chocolate cake mix cookies
- 6 scoops Mint Chocolate Chip Ice Cream
- 1 cup semi-sweet chocolate chips
- 2 tablespoons butter
- Candy sprinkles
Instructions
- For the Cookies
- Mix all cookie ingredients in a large mixing bowl until well combined.
- Scoop tablespoon-sized balls of dough and place them onto an ungreased cookie sheet, spaced apart.
- Bake in a preheated oven at 350 degrees Fahrenheit (175°C) for 8 to 10 minutes, or until edges are set.
- Allow cookies to cool completely on the baking sheet before handling.
- For the Sandwiches
- Take 6 of the cooled cookies and place a generous scoop of mint chocolate chip ice cream on the flat bottom of each.
- Gently top with the remaining 6 cookies, pressing down lightly until the ice cream reaches the edges.
- Place the assembled sandwiches in the freezer for about 10 minutes to firm up slightly.
- While sandwiches are chilling, melt chocolate chips and 2 tablespoons butter in a microwave-safe bowl for 30 seconds. Stir well.
- If not fully melted, microwave for additional 10-second intervals, stirring after each, until the mixture is fully melted and glossy.
- Dip half of each firm cookie ice cream sandwich into the melted chocolate.
- Immediately top the dipped chocolate side with candy sprinkles before the chocolate hardens.
- Store the finished ice cream sandwiches in the freezer until ready to eat.
Notes
Dipped chocolate coating is optional. You can serve the cookie sandwiches as is or use a store-bought magic shell topping for easier dipping.
For longer storage, wrap each individual cookie sandwich tightly in freezer paper or plastic wrap to prevent freezer burn.
